shell是什么:
shell是一个命令解释器,他接受应用程序和用户命令,然后调用操作系统内核。
shell也是一个功能相当强大的编程语言,具有易编写,易调试,灵活性强的特点
shell的解析器:
shell脚本编写:
需求:创建一个shell脚本,输出hello world!
实操:
j
脚本格式:需要在shell文件开始加入#!/bin/bash
shell的变量:
常用变量:
$HOME $PWD $ SHELL $USER
显示当前shell中所用变量 :set
自定义变量:
语法:变量=值
撤销变量:unset 变量
声明静态变量:readonly 变量,注意不能使用unset